The Canada Package Testing Market is primarily driven by the increasing demand for product safety and quality assurance in the packaging industry. Stringent regulations and standards set by regulatory bodies such as the Canadian Food Inspection Agency (CFIA) and the Canadian Food and Drugs Act require thorough testing of packaging materials to ensure they meet the necessary criteria for protecting products during transportation and storage. Additionally, the rise in e-commerce activities in Canada has led to a greater need for package testing to prevent damages during shipping and to enhance the overall customer experience. Advancements in technology, such as the adoption of various testing methods like vibration testing, drop testing, and compression testing, also contribute to the growth of the package testing market in Canada.
Government policies related to the Canada Package Testing Market are primarily aimed at ensuring consumer safety and environmental protection. The Canadian government enforces regulations such as the Consumer Packaging and Labelling Act, which requires accurate labeling of packages to provide consumers with essential information. Additionally, the Canadian Food Inspection Agency (CFIA) oversees the safety and quality of food packaging materials and ensures compliance with packaging regulations. Environmentally, the government promotes sustainable packaging practices through initiatives like the Extended Producer Responsibility (EPR) program, which holds manufacturers accountable for the disposal and recycling of their packaging materials. Overall, government policies in Canada emphasize the importance of package testing to uphold product safety, consumer rights, and environmental sustainability in the market.
